Git项目实战教程:深度解读Mi proyecto con Git

需积分: 5 0 下载量 19 浏览量 更新于2024-12-15 收藏 1KB ZIP 举报
资源摘要信息:"git-course:Mi proyecto con Git" 知识点一:Git课程介绍 Git是一款流行的版本控制系统,它在软件开发过程中被广泛使用,以跟踪和管理源代码的变更。Git能够快速高效地处理小至单一文件、大至大型项目代码库的变更。其课程"git-course:Mi proyecto con Git"由埃斯特·德·普鲁瓦巴·Kong吉特主讲,适合想要学习Git实际应用和理解其在项目管理中的作用的学习者。 知识点二:Git基础概念 在开始使用Git之前,需要了解几个核心概念,包括仓库(repository)、工作目录(working directory)、暂存区(staging area)和提交(commit)。 - 仓库(Repository)是存储所有项目文件历史记录的地方。 - 工作目录是当前文件的目录,包含仓库文件的副本。 - 暂存区(也称为索引)是对文件的更改进行临时存储的地方,以便在提交之前对这些更改进行管理。 - 提交(Commit)是对项目当前状态的快照,是代码更改的一个时间点。 知识点三:Git项目初始化和基本操作 1. 初始化(git init):在项目根目录下运行此命令,以创建一个新的Git仓库。 2. 添加(git add):将工作目录中的更改添加到暂存区。 3. 提交(git commit):提交暂存区中的更改到仓库历史记录。 4. 查看状态(git status):检查工作目录和暂存区的状态,了解哪些更改已被暂存,哪些还未提交。 5. 查看提交历史(git log):展示项目提交历史的详细信息。 知识点四:分支管理 Git支持分支管理,允许开发者在不同的开发线路上工作,而不会影响主项目的代码。主要命令有: - 创建分支(git branch <branchname>):在当前提交上创建一个新分支。 - 切换分支(git checkout <branchname>):切换到指定分支进行工作。 - 合并分支(git merge <branchname>):将指定分支的更改合并到当前分支。 - 删除分支(git branch -d <branchname>):删除指定分支。 知识点五:远程仓库操作 远程仓库(如GitHub、GitLab等)是Git项目的云端副本,便于团队协作和代码共享。与远程仓库交互的常用命令包括: - 克隆(git clone <repository-url>):从远程仓库克隆项目到本地。 - 推送(git push):将本地的更改推送到远程仓库。 - 拉取(git pull):从远程仓库拉取最新的更改到本地。 - 远程仓库配置(git remote):查看和管理远程仓库配置信息。 知识点六:HTML标签使用 HTML是一种用于创建网页的标准标记语言。标签是HTML的基本构建块,用来定义网页的结构和内容。本课程中虽然主要关注Git,但在开发过程中常常会涉及到与HTML的结合使用。 - 基本HTML结构:包括<!DOCTYPE html>、<html>、<head>和<body>等标签。 - 文本相关标签:如<p>(段落)、<h1>到<h6>(标题)、<strong>(强调文本)、<em>(斜体文本)等。 - 链接和图像:如<a href="URL">(创建链接)和<img src="URL" alt="描述">(插入图像)。 - 列表和表格:如<ul>、<ol>和<dl>(无序列表、有序列表和描述列表)、<table>(表格)等。 - 表单:如<form>(创建表单)、<input>(输入元素)、<button>(按钮)等。 知识点七:项目实战应用 该课程可能包含一个或多个实战项目,通过具体的案例来展示如何将Git应用到真实项目中。实战操作中,学习者将学习如何初始化项目仓库、创建分支、合并代码、解决冲突、使用标签(tagging)进行版本管理、以及如何与远程仓库进行交互等。这些操作将帮助学习者建立工作流程,并理解在软件开发周期中版本控制的作用。 通过学习这些知识点,学习者能够掌握Git的基本原理和操作技巧,从而有效管理个人或团队的项目代码,并能够与全球范围内的协作伙伴共同工作。